The IEC 60287 does not list materials for filler but states: depending on the filler material and its compaction, the thermal resistivity is in the range 6 to 13 K.m/W for cables with extruded insulation, 10 K.m/W is suggested for fibrous polypropylene.
Following values are taken from IEC 60287-2-1 for insulation or jacket with following additions:
Material | Value | Reference |
---|---|---|
fPOC | 6.6 | Handbook of Polyolefins |
fPP | 9.0 | Hearle and Morton 2008 |
fPE | 7.0 | = 2 x sPE |
fPVC | 12.0 | = 2 x sPVC |
sPVC | 6.0 | IEC 60287-2-1 |
sPE | 3.5 | PE, IEC 60287-2-1 |
PRod | 8.0 | mix plastic/air |
PTube | 12.0 | mix plastic/air |
OilD | 6.0 | OilP, IEC 60287-2-1 |
TY | 5.3 | |
Jute | 6.0 | IEC 60287-2-1 |
tape | 6.0 | mix |
Air | 38.2 | engineeringtoolbox.com |
Ot | 10.0 | fibrous polypropylene, IEC 60287-2-1 |
